







The Gleneagle Hotel has launched a new Quiet Room for employees that is designed to provide team members with a space where they can recharge, engage in mindfulness and relaxation exercises, or simply enjoy a moment of silence.
“Quiet rooms reduce workplace stress and improve well-being. We have designed this space to cater to any member of our team seeking timeout from the hustle and bustle of the workplace. It is part of our ongoing commitment to creating an exceptional workplace for our employees” said Eilis Loughrey, Director of People and Culture for The Gleneagle Group.
“We hope that this addition will provide our team with a space to relax when needed, ultimately benefiting both our employees and the business.”
As part of their ongoing commitment to employee wellbeing, team members at The Gleneagle Group also receive complimentary access to leisure centre facilities, access to trained mental health first aiders, social events for employees and their families, meals on duty, learning and development opportunities, and regular employee rewards for exceptional behaviour.
